Pelosi urges negotiated, comprehensive settlement in South Caucasus

PanARMENIAN.Net - Members of the U.S. Congress delivered remarks at the Congressional Armenian Genocide Observance 2023, Armenpress reports.

Congresswoman Nancy Pelosi, Senator Robert Menendez, Congressman Frank Pallone, Congressman Adam Schiff and others spoke about the U.S. recognition of the Armenian Genocide and the need to stop aid to Azerbaijan amid its aggression against Artsakh and Armenia.

“There must be a negotiated, comprehensive and lasting settlement to this conflict so that we can pave a way to peace and security. Make no mistake, support for the Armenian people transcends partisanships and politics. This is very bipartisan. America will be there as Armenia holds down in the forefronts in the battle of democracy versus autocracy. We saw that when we were there,” Pelosi said in her remarks about the Nagorno Karabakh conflict.

As Speaker of the U.S. House of Representatives, Pelosi traveled to Armenia in September 2022.
